Output 31ec429a2e76abb3f290cd99b8d4229b92f0afd1191997a7014ccefee0439519:0

value
895353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812a2124f3e360de5f1abda3b53522273159ac7b OP_EQUAL
address
3DTyZVmR2Vvj1RJ8PeiABYEACf9XECJXHM
transaction
31ec429a2e76abb3f290cd99b8d4229b92f0afd1191997a7014ccefee0439519
spent
true